SEC: Approval Of Order To Extend The Termination Date Of The Short Sale Pilot Order
Date 21/04/2006
On April 20, 2006, the Securities and Exchange Commission approved an order to extend the termination date of the short sale Pilot to Aug. 6, 2007. The Pilot temporarily suspends short sale price tests for certain securities so that the Commission can determine the effectiveness of such price tests and the impact of short selling in the absence of price tests. Oslo Børs: Changes To The OBX Index Create Better Investment Opportunities
Date 21/04/2006
Oslo Børs is making major changes to the OBX index with effect from Friday 21 April. The most important changes are that the index will be split 4:1 (reduced to one quarter of the current value) and become a true yield index. In addition, fees are being reduced significantly. The changes are intended to make it easier and cheaper for investors to trade in derivatives.
